You may need to supply the air horns via an uprated relay as they may require a higher drive current.
The problem with modern cars with CAN bus is that the system identifies and flags-up problems (warning-light/warning sound)....and replacing an original part (the original horn) with a different part (your chosen air-horn) is seen as a problem (unless the two parts have identical specs- which is quite unlikely). Not only can you have "error" warnings, but the replacement probably won't work anyway.
(Even changing original standard brake-light bulbs for LED versions can lead to CAN bus errors).
My advice, if you go ahead, is to source the air-horn from somewhere that accepts returns with no hassle.
